Description: Thermal AWG module performs DWDM Mux and Demux by utilizing waveguide chips based on the silica on silicon technilogy. It has a built-in temperature control circuit with customer adjustable setting working temperature for fine temperature control so the device will work in a stable controolled temperature. The TAWG is built in a standard package by following MSA guidance with full qualication of Telcordia GR-468 qualified, and in compliance with RoHS directives.
